HUBUNGAN TINGKAT STRES TERHADAP NILAI MCV, MCH, DAN MCHC MELALUI PENDEKATAN INDEKS ERITEMA PADA MANUSIA DENGAN RENTANG UMUR 19-22 TAHUN
Abstrak
Stres merupakan perasaan tertekan terhadap tuntutan yang sedang dihadapi. Stres juga diketahui mempengaruhi variabel erythron, sistem endokrin, hematopoietik, dan kekebalan tubuh. Status hematopoietik dapat ditentukan melalui pengukuran nilai indeks eritrosit. Penelitian ini dilakukan untuk mengetahui hubungan tingkat stres terhadap nilai MCH, MCV, dan MCHC melalui pendekatan indeks eritema konjungtiva pada manusia normal. Subjek uji pada penelitian ini meliputi 150 mahasiswa farmasi Universitas Padjadjaran dimana 114 sukarelawan dengan data penelitian yang lengkap digunakan sebagai subjek uji akhir. Metode pada penelitian ini menggunakan pendekatan Cross Sectional. Pengecekan tingkat stres dilakukan menggunakan kuisioner stres pada instrumen DASS 42 serta aplikasi image analyzer (MATLAB) digunakan untuk mengukur indeks eritema. Tingkat stres dinyatakan sebagai nilai (skor) hasil pengisian kuisioner dan indeks eritema diketahui sebagai nilai perbedaan intensitas warna merah dan hijau pada konjungtiva mata. Berdasarkan uji Korelasi Pearson didapat nilai signifikansi >0,05 (0,847) yang menandakan bahwa tidak terdapat hubungan yang signifikan antara tingkat stres dengan indeks eritema. Nilai korelasi Pearson -0,018 menandakan bahwa korelasi antara tingkat stres dan indeks eritema bersifat negatif (protective factor) dengan level korelasi sangat rendah. Dengan pendekatan bahwa indeks eritema berbanding lurus dengan nilai indeks eritrosit (MCH, MCV, dan MCHC), maka hasil uji statistik juga menyatakan secara tidak langsung hal yang sama mengenai hubungan tingkat stres terhadap nilai MCH, MCV, dan MCHC.

ABTRACT
Stress is feeling depressed about problem being faced. Stress is also known to affect the erythron, endocrine, hematopoietic, and immune variables. Hematopoietic status can be determined by measuring the erythrocyte index value. This study was conducted to determine the relationship of stress levels to the value of MCH, MCV, and MCHC through the conjunctival erythema index approach in normal humans. Subjects in this study included 150 pharmacy students from Universitas Padjadjaran where 114 volunteers with complete research data were used as final subjects. The method in this study uses a Cross Sectional approach. Stress level measurement is performed using a stress questionnaire on the DASS 42 instrument and the application of an image analyzer (MATLAB) is used to measure the erythema index. The stress level is expressed as a value (score) from the filling out of the questionnaire and the erythema index is known as the value of the difference in the intensity of the red and green color in the eye conjunctiva. Pearson Correlation statistical test have showed a P-value> 0.05 (0.847) which indicates that there is no significant relationship between the level of stress with the erythema index. The Pearson correlation value of -0.018 indicates that the correlation between the stress level and the erythema index is negative (protective factor) with a very low level of correlation. With the approach that the erythema index is indirectly proportional to the erythrocyte index value (MCH, MCV, and MCHC), the statistical test results also imply the same conclusion about the relationship of stress levels to the value of MCH, MCV, and MCHC.
